The principal minors of a symmetric $n{\times}n$-matrix form a vector of length $2^n$. We characterize these vectors in terms of algebraic equations derived from the $ 2{\times}2{\times}2$-hyperdeterminant.

环与代数 · 数学 2007-10-13 Olga Holtz , Bernd Sturmfels
